Output 15b30729ebf70caa3f9f5ca6d314fa754e679d61e61174bdd21f8293dbdce7af:2

value
330840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68486e9a016a9903ffe406ae581510ad2bf698f8 OP_EQUAL
address
3BCQyAFXWw2jWMMQv9rd7WLAQNUkxEZxon
transaction
15b30729ebf70caa3f9f5ca6d314fa754e679d61e61174bdd21f8293dbdce7af
spent
true